  1. “to the extent that the standard State Farm contract may be interpreted to circumvent basic concepts of Louisiana property law and the rights of spouses with regard to fruits under the Louisiana community property regime, it is against public policy and, therefore, unenforceable.”

  2. “that the State Farm agency, including any income earned by Mr. Lanza after the filing of the Petition for Divorce, is not property subject to partition, nor is it community property to which [Ms. Coudrain] holds an ownership interest.”

  3. “renewal commissions received by Mr. Ross during the existence of the community property regime were the result of Mr. Ross' effort, skill and industry exerted during the community regime.”
